How they compare
Peru currently reports -0.5% against -0.7% in Mexico, a difference of 0.2%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 8 shared years of data; in 2008 it was Mexico ahead.
Mexico ranks 25th and Peru ranks 24th of 29 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Mexico averaged higher in 1 and Peru in 2.
